KWSG trains 300 youths via ICT, mobile money
The empowerment training which is holding at the Computer Based Test (CBT) of the University of Ilorin was a product of tripartite arrangement between the Kwara State Government, the YABA TECH Consult and the Stanbic IBTC bank.
Speaking earlier during the official flag-off of the training held at the University of Ilorin Main Auditorium, the Kwara State Governor, Alhaji Abdulfatah Ahmed described the exercise as part of pragmatic approach to further empower army of youths in the state using ICT as a platform.
The Governor who was represented at the occasion by the state Commissioner for Youths and Sport, Hajia Ramat Adesina Abaya said the participants will gain computer literacy skills and operate the business of mobile money agents on Stanbic IBTC platform in line with the Central Bank of Nigeria (CBN) cashless policy.
“This scheme is designed in a way that selected beneficiaries who complete and excel in computer literacy skills assessment exams and register with Stanbic IBTC bank mobile money platform by the state government will act as mobile bakers in their villages or communities where access to bank service are limited,“ she said.
In his comment, the Chairman, State House of Assembly Committee on Sport and Youth Development, Hon. Adamu Ibrahim Sabi who said that the era of typewriter has gone into extinction in present day world and commended the office of Special Assistant to the Governor on Youth Empowerment for taking this bold step towards empowering the Kwara youths.
Earlier in his welcome address, the Special Assistant to the Governor on Youth Empowerment, Alhaji Sakariyahu Babatunde who said that the importance of ICT cannot be over emphasized in the modern day world said hardly can any programmes be done without the input of ICT.
This, according to him, explained why his office decided to train youth on ICT in partnership with Stanbic IBTC bank and YABA TECH Consult as a way of empowering our youth to be job creators.
